How popular is Adiela right now?
Falling — down 1228 spots — currently #13485 in the US out of 135.5k tracked names
| Year | US Rank | Births | vs Prior Year |
|---|
| 2023 | #13485 | 6 | ▼ down 1228 · -14% births |
| 2022 | #12257 | 7 | ▼ down 1458 · -30% births |
| 2015 | #10799 | 10 | — |
The story of Adiela
Adiela is a relatively modern name, first appearing in US records in 2012. With 37 total births recorded, Adiela remains relatively uncommon. Once ranked #10799 in 2015, the name has become less common in recent years, sitting at #13485 in 2023.
